14 Horringford Road, Liverpool, Merseyside, L19 3QX has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 13 Jan 2022.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ows have partial double glazing.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 16 Apr 2012, when the property was rated F. Since then, the rating has improved to D,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 68.4%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The heating system was upgraded from room heaters, mains gas to boiler and radiators, mains gas, improving energy efficiency from average to good.
  • The hot water system was changed from electric immersion, standard tariff to from main system, with its energy efficiency improving from very poor to good.
  • The windows were upgraded from single glazed to partial double glazing.
  • The lighting was updated from no low energy lighting to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from very poor to very good.
